KYC Checks: The Necessary Evil (and How to Beat It)
You want the best live casino fast withdrawal australia 2026? Then you need to do your KYC (Know Your Customer) BEFORE you win. I can’t stress this enough. Do not wait until you have $500 in your account to upload your driver’s license. Do it on a Tuesday afternoon when you sign up.
Most sites will let you upload your ID and a utility bill during registration. If you don’t, and you hit a big win on a live poker hand, they will lock your account for 72 hours. I’ve seen it happen. It’s a nightmare.
A Quick Tip for Aussie Players
Use your passport. It’s usually faster than a driver’s license. Also, make sure your name on the casino account matches your bank account exactly. If you have a middle name, put it in. Don’t get cute. The system will flag it.
So, What’s the Catch with “Fast Withdrawal” Promises?
Here’s where I contradict myself a bit. A lot of sites advertise “instant withdrawal” but that only applies to e-wallets like Skrill or Neteller. If you want to withdraw straight to your Australian bank account, it usually takes 1-3 business days. No one tells you that upfront. They just say “instant”.
But, there are a few new platforms in 2026 that are pushing “PayID” withdrawals. PayID is a system that lets you get money into your bank account almost instantly. It’s not available everywhere, but for live casino fast withdrawal in Australia, it is the holy grail. If a site offers PayID, I’m interested.

FAQ: The Bits I Get Asked Most
What is the fastest withdrawal method for live casino in Australia?
PayID or Crypto (Bitcoin/Ethereum) are the fastest. E-wallets like Skrill are close second. Bank transfers are the slowest. Avoid them if you can.
Do I have to pay taxes on my live casino winnings in Australia?
No. As an Aussie player, you don’t pay tax on gambling winnings. The casino doesn’t withhold anything either. It’s all yours. Just don’t ask me about the ATO and professional gamblers. That’s a different story.
Are there any wagering requirements on the live casino bonus?
Usually yes. Most bonuses for live casino have a 35x or 50x wagering requirement on the bonus amount. Some sites exclude live games from the bonus entirely. Always read the T&C. Look for “No Wagering” offers, they are rare but they exist (like PlayOJO).
